Klasifikasi Teks: Sebuah Tinjauan Komprehensif

essays-star 4 (328 suara)

Klasifikasi teks adalah tugas penting dalam pemrosesan bahasa alami (NLP) yang melibatkan pengkategorian teks ke dalam kelompok atau kelas yang telah ditentukan sebelumnya. Dari penyaringan email hingga analisis sentimen dan penandaan topik, klasifikasi teks memainkan peran penting dalam berbagai aplikasi modern. Artikel ini menggali dunia klasifikasi teks, mengeksplorasi konsep-konsep kunci, metodologi, dan aplikasi terkemukanya.

Memahami Klasifikasi Teks

Pada intinya, klasifikasi teks bertujuan untuk menetapkan label atau kategori ke dokumen teks yang diberikan berdasarkan kontennya. Proses ini melibatkan pelatihan model pada kumpulan data berlabel, memungkinkannya untuk mempelajari pola dan hubungan antara teks dan kategori yang sesuai. Setelah dilatih, model dapat mengklasifikasikan teks yang tidak terlihat ke dalam kategori yang dipelajari.

Teknik Klasifikasi Teks

Berbagai teknik telah muncul untuk klasifikasi teks, masing-masing dengan kekuatan dan kelemahannya sendiri. Salah satu pendekatan yang banyak digunakan adalah pembelajaran mesin tradisional, yang melibatkan algoritma seperti mesin vektor pendukung (SVM), regresi logistik, dan Naive Bayes. Algoritma ini telah terbukti efektif dalam tugas klasifikasi teks dan menawarkan interpretabilitas dan kemudahan implementasi.

Dalam beberapa tahun terakhir, teknik pembelajaran mendalam telah merevolusi NLP, termasuk klasifikasi teks. Jaringan saraf seperti jaringan saraf berulang (RNN) dan jaringan memori jangka pendek panjang (LSTM) telah mencapai akurasi yang canggih dalam tugas-tugas yang melibatkan data berurutan seperti teks. Terutama, model transformator, seperti BERT dan GPT-3, telah menunjukkan kemampuan luar biasa dalam memahami konteks dan semantik, yang mengarah pada peningkatan kinerja dalam berbagai tolok ukur klasifikasi teks.

Aplikasi Klasifikasi Teks

Klasifikasi teks menemukan aplikasi di berbagai domain, merevolusi cara kita berinteraksi dengan informasi dan mengotomatiskan tugas-tugas.

1. Analisis Sentimen: Klasifikasi teks memungkinkan bisnis untuk menganalisis sentimen yang diungkapkan dalam ulasan pelanggan, postingan media sosial, dan umpan balik untuk memahami persepsi publik, mengidentifikasi area yang perlu ditingkatkan, dan menyesuaikan strategi mereka.

2. Penyaringan Spam: Klasifikasi teks memainkan peran penting dalam mengidentifikasi dan menyaring email spam, memastikan bahwa pengguna menerima korespondensi yang relevan dan dapat dipercaya.

3. Penandaan Topik: Klasifikasi teks memungkinkan organisasi untuk mengkategorikan artikel berita, postingan blog, dan dokumen lainnya ke dalam topik atau kategori tertentu, memfasilitasi pengorganisasian dan pengambilan informasi yang efisien.

4. Dukungan Pelanggan: Chatbots dan asisten virtual yang diberdayakan oleh klasifikasi teks dapat memahami pertanyaan pelanggan dan mengarahkan mereka ke sumber daya atau departemen yang sesuai, meningkatkan kepuasan dan efisiensi.

5. Penemuan Obat: Klasifikasi teks membantu peneliti menganalisis literatur ilmiah, mengidentifikasi pola dan hubungan potensial yang dapat mengarah pada penemuan dan pengembangan obat baru.

Kesimpulan

Klasifikasi teks adalah tugas penting dalam NLP dengan banyak aplikasi. Dari analisis sentimen hingga penyaringan spam dan penemuan obat, klasifikasi teks merevolusi cara kita memproses dan mengekstrak wawasan dari data teks. Seiring kemajuan teknologi, kita dapat mengharapkan teknik klasifikasi teks yang lebih canggih dan inovatif muncul, yang selanjutnya meningkatkan kemampuan kita dalam memahami dan memanfaatkan kekuatan bahasa.